Long story short, I was transporting my elephant ear to my new home, asked my teenagers if they brought everything in--of course they said they did but they left my plant in the car for 3 hours in 100+ heat. All of the leaves and most of the stems have turned black and withered. Will it come back from this or do you think I've lost it?

I doubt that 3 hours was enough time to cook the bulb. I would cut off all the leaves and wait for some new sprouts. What have you got to lose? Good luck!
